Just got the data for todays game versus the Diamondbacks from MLB.com and it looks like the person operating the Pitch F/X machine at GABP was not paying attention for most of the game. The operator missed about 100 pitches in the system. Oh well, nothing we can do about it now.
Some new things in this years Pitch F/X system that I noticed though:
- Sv_Id - Looks like the id number for the operator as it is missing on every pitch missing data.
- Pitch_Type -Looks like they added a pitch description to each pitch as well. Can’t say how accurate it is yet as there isn’t enough data to figure it out yet (at least for me doing just the Reds). I am sure someone that does all of baseball with have better answers soon enough.
- Type_Confidence - Not sure what this is either, but I am sure someone smarter than myself will figure it out soon enough.
